CREATE an IMAGE-STORAGE PAGE:



     After you have uploaded the image to your scrapbook, you will then need to put it onto a published storage-page in order to obtain its URL to link it someplace else, such as into your sig-box or webpage.

     If you don't already have an image-storage page to link from, then follow these steps to create one:



  • Go to Pagebuilder; and
  • Click on "Create"
  • Select the "Grey" background (on page 2)
  • Title your page "gif" (keep it simple)
  • Click on "Add an item"
  • Click on "Picture"
  • Click on "Your Scrapbook"
  • Click on your image
  • Click on "Done"
  • Click on "Publish"
  • Do NOT EVER check the "Show title on page" box

To use your extracted image:

  • Put your newly extracted URL into the code - (but, you must delete the "-1" or "-2" number after "community" in the image's URL):

    <img src="URL">

  • Paste the code into your sig-box or webpage


     This is an example of what an extracted URL will look like:

http://community-2.webtv.net/kdine4/gif/scrapbookFiles/importD36.gif

     But, don't forget to delete the "-2" (or, "-1") thingy from its URL:

http://community.webtv.net/kdine4/gif/scrapbookFiles/importD36.gif

     Then, put the URL in this code:

<img src="http://community.webtv.net/kdine4/gif/scrapbookFiles/importD36.gif">
